Abellio West London Limited (Supplier №116556): address, contacts, e-mail tenders



Address: 301 Camberwell New Road London SE5 0TF
Contracts: 8
Awarded Sum: 11 592 558
Currency: GBP
Contracts information is published selectively

Please register to watch info


and many others... Suppliers

Number: 116550

Number: 116551

Number: 116552

Number: 116553

Number: 116554

Number: 116555